3. Audi basically adopts the layout of vertical engine, and Volkswagen adopts the layout of horizontal engine. By doing so, Audi makes the rotation direction of the engine consistent with the running direction of the transmission shaft, reduces the transmission structure for adjusting the direction and reduces the energy loss.
